Frequently Asked Questions

The NTSB Aviation Accident Database is a comprehensive record of all civil aviation accidents and incidents investigated by the National Transportation Safety Board. It includes event details, aircraft information, weather conditions, injury data, and narrative reports from investigators.

Fatalities are the total number of deaths resulting from the event. Injuries include serious injuries requiring hospitalization. These counts cover all persons involved — crew, passengers, and ground casualties.
